Intel is considering a return to the memory business, with CEO Pat Gelsinger hinting at potential innovation in memory architecture. Gelsinger mentioned hiring Seok-Hee Lee, formerly of SK Hynix, to lead these efforts. While details remain scarce, the company suggests the market is ripe for new developments in this area. AI
